Site Prep
Includes everything you need in preparation to ready your site for construction.
Site Prep Steps:
- Clearing the Land: Removing trees, vegetation, rocks, and debris to prepare a clean area for building.
- Grading: Leveling the ground to ensure proper drainage and a stable foundation.
- Excavation: Digging for the foundation, basements, or utility lines.
- Installing Utilities: Laying down the necessary infrastructure for water, electricity, gas, and sewage.
- Soil Testing: Assessing soil to ensure suitability for construction and needed treatments.

Exterior Siding Installation
Siding protects your home from weather, moisture, and pests, preventing damage while improving insulation to lower energy costs. With various materials and styles, it boosts curb appeal and can be customized to your preferences.
